The DSE704 is an Auto Mains Failure Control Module that offers an excellent range of engine monitoring and protection features. The module has been designed to monitor engine temperature, low oil pressure, fail to start, charge failure, over speed and under speed. When the module detects a fault condition it automatically shuts down the engine. The module also includes two user configurable auxiliary inputs. The module has been designed to automatically start the generator when the mains (utility) power fails. As soon as mains (utility) power is restored the module has been designed to transfer the load back to the mains (utility) supply. The module then instructs the engine to begin the cool down procedure and stopping sequence (user configured).

The DSE720 is an Automatic Mains Failure Control Module that offers an advanced range of engine monitoring and protection features. The module has been designed to monitors a mains supply and switch over to the generator when the mains power fails. The module monitors generator frequency, generator volts, generator current, engine oil pressure, engine coolant temperature, engine running hours and battery volts. The module also displays the engine speed. When the module detects a fault condition it automatically shuts down the engine and indicates the exact fault on the modules LCD display or relevant LED indicator. The module can be configured using the front panel or via the DSE810 interface and a PC. The module can also be controlled from a PC that is located up to 100 meters away.

The DSE5220 is an Automatic Mains Failure Control Module designed to monitor a mains (utility) supply and automatically start and stop diesel and gas generating sets that include non electronic engines. Upon detection of a mains (utility) failure the module automatically starts the generating set. Once the mains power has been restored the module instructs the generating set to stop. The module also provides excellent engine monitoring and protection features. The module has the ability to monitor under speed, over speed, charge failure, emergency stop, low oil pressure, high engine temperature, fail to start, fail to stop, under/over generator volts, over current, under/over generator frequency, low/high DC battery volts, low fuel alarm and loss of the speed sensing signal. The module displays fault conditions on the LCD display and via the LED indicators on the front of the panel. The module includes RS232 or RS485 communications capabilities for linking to a PC, sending SMS messages and interfacing with new and existing building management systems.

The DSE7220 is a new control module for single gen-set applications. The module has been developed from the successful DSE5220 and incorporates a number of advanced features to meet the most demanding on-site applications. The DSE7220 is an Auto Mains (Utility) Failure Control Module designed to start and stop diesel and gas generating sets that include electronic and non-electronic engines. The module has the capability of being able to monitor a mains (utility) supply. Modules are simple to operate and feature a newly designed menu layout for improved clarity. Enhanced features include a real time clock for improved event and performance monitoring, the ability to display any language on screen and a 132 x 64 pixel LCD display.

The DSE7320 is a new control module for single gen-set applications. The module has been developed from the successful DSE5320 and incorporates a number of advanced features to meet the most demanding on-site applications. The DSE7320 is an Auto Mains (Utility) Failure Control Module designed to start and stop diesel and gas generating sets that include electronic and non-electronic engines. The DSE7320 includes the capability of being able to monitor a mains (utility) supply.
Modules include USB, RS232 and RS485 ports as well as dedicated DSENet® terminals for expansion device connectivity. The modules are simple to operate and feature a newly designed menu layout for improved clarity. Enhanced features include a real time clock for enhanced event and performance monitoring, Ethernet communications for low cost monitoring, mutual standby to reduce engine wear and tear, trend analysis to assist in the detection of patterns in engine status and preventative maintenance designed to detect if engine parts have developed fault conditions so they can be replaced before a major problem occurs.

The DSE5520 is an Automatic Mains Failure Control Module designed to provide advanced load share functionality for diesel and gas generating sets that include non electronic and electronic engines. The module also provides excellent engine monitoring and protection features. The module monitors the mains (utility) supply and upon detection of a loss in power automatically starts the generating set. The modules synchronising functions include automatic synchronising with built in synchroscope and closing onto dead bus. Direct and flexible outputs from the module are provided to allow connection to the most commonly used speed governors and automatic voltage regulators (AVR’s). The module has the ability to monitor under/over generator volts, over current, under/over generator frequency, under speed, over speed, charge fail, emergency stop, low oil pressure, high engine temperature, fail to start, low/high DC battery volts, fail to stop, generator short circuit protection, reverse power, generator phase rotation error, earth fault protection, loss of speed signal, fail to open, fail to close, out of sync and MPU open circuit failure, negative phase sequence and loss of excitation.

The DSE5560 is an Automatic Transfer Switch and Mains Control Module, designed to automatically synchronise multiple DSE5510’s with single or multiple mains (utility) supplies. The module instructs the DSE5510’s to make precise changes to the generating set outputs. This makes the module suitable for many applications including peak lopping, peak shaving and no break return. The module has the ability to monitor the mains (utility) supply and start and stop the generating sets (being controlled by a DSE5510) upon removal or detection of the mains (utility) supply. The modules operational status is indicated on the LCD display and the front panel LED’s.

The DSE555 is an Automatic Mains Failure Control Module with comprehensive instrumentation and load control option. The module is used to monitor a mains supply and automatically start and stop the engine. It indicates the operational status and fault conditions, automatically shutting down the engine and indicating engine failure by means of an LCD display and flashing LED on the front panel.
Selected operatinal sequences, timers and alarms can be altered by the customer. Alterations to the system are made using the DSE810 PC interface and a PC.
It is also possible to monitor the operation of the system either locally or remotely.

The configurable Automatic Mains Failure Module allows many of the industry's demanding specifications to be achieved. Variations of the unit offer additional functions like RS232 interface for remote monitoring by a volt free relay module, annunciator or building management system.
The DSE509 is used to start a generator on a mains (utility) failure and transfer the load when the engine's operating criteria has been met. On return of the mains supply, the engine is returned to standby mode.
